Cornell absolutely does distinguish between tuition and fees....When my first child entered CALS in 2000, fees constituted about half of the non-housing/dining bill we had to pay. Which took us by surprise and therefore required loans since we had only budgeted to pay room and board thinking "tuition" was free. I started at Cornell in the 70's so my kids went to school tuition free.by dag14 - Hockey

Remember, too, that freshmen couldn't play varsity when Ned coached so the possible line combinations for each incoming class were more limited. By default a line could be pretty well established when the players moved to varsity.by dag14 - Hockey
